Family Rebellion Summer Salad
Dressing:
¼ c oil
2 Tbsp parsley flake
2 Tbsp red wine vinegar
½ tsp salt
¼ tsp pepper
1 clove garlic, finely minced
Combine last 5 ingredients and whisk into oil. Whisk until well-blended.
16 oz can green beans, drained
16 oz can kidney beans, drained
1 cup cherry tomatoes, chopped in half
½ c black olives, sliced
1 medium red onion, chopped
Combine, cover, and refrigerate.
